What Are the Financial Considerations for Body Transformations in Malta?

Understanding the cost structure of body contouring procedures helps patients plan appropriately and avoid unexpected expenses. Pricing varies based on the specific technique employed, the extent of treatment required, the surgeon’s experience, and the facility where the procedure is performed. Generally, Malta offers competitive rates compared to countries like the United Kingdom, Germany, or Switzerland, though prices remain higher than some destinations in Eastern Europe or Asia. Patients should request detailed quotes that include surgeon fees, anesthesia, facility costs, post-operative garments, and follow-up appointments. It is advisable to budget for potential additional expenses such as accommodation, travel, and time away from work during recovery.


Procedure Type Estimated Cost Range (EUR) Typical Recovery Time
Abdominal Contouring 3,500 - 6,500 2-4 weeks
Thigh Sculpting 3,000 - 5,500 2-3 weeks
Arm Refinement 2,500 - 4,500 1-2 weeks
Full Body Contouring 8,000 - 15,000 4-6 weeks
Non-Surgical Options 500 - 2,500 per session Minimal to none

What Should Prospective Patients Consider Before Proceeding?

Before committing to body contouring procedures in Malta, thorough research and preparation are essential. Prospective patients should verify that their chosen surgeon is registered with the appropriate medical authorities and holds valid certifications in plastic or cosmetic surgery. Reading patient reviews, viewing documented results, and seeking second opinions can provide additional confidence. Understanding the risks, potential complications, and realistic outcomes prevents disappointment and ensures informed consent. Patients should also assess their overall health, as certain medical conditions may contraindicate elective cosmetic surgery. Planning for recovery time, arranging post-operative care, and setting realistic expectations contribute to a positive experience. Transparent communication with healthcare providers throughout the process is crucial for achieving satisfactory results.
